
随着移动应用的快速发展,越来越多的开发者开始采用多渠道发布的方式,把同一个APP打包成多个版本,分别发布到不同的应用商店或平台。比如,有的版本针对国内用户,有的针对海外用户,还有的是为特定品牌定制的版本。这种做法虽然能扩大用户覆盖范围,但也给测试带来了新的挑战。
那么问题来了:如何在这么多不同版本中,高效地进行测试,确保每个渠道的版本都能正常运行呢?
https://www.hainrtvu.com/kiozf/49.html其实,关键在于“差异化测试”。也就是说,不能用一套测试方法去测试所有版本,而是要根据每个渠道的特点,制定不同的测试策略。
首先,我们可以从功能上区分。比如,某些渠道可能支持特定的功能,而其他渠道可能不支持。这时候,我们就需要对这些功能进行重点测试,确保它们在对应渠道中没有问题。
其次,界面和语言也是差异点之一。不同地区的用户可能使用不同的语言,界面布局也可能有所调整。测试时,可以先检查语言是否正确,再看看界面是否显示正常,有没有错位或者乱码的情况。
另外,还可以利用自动化测试工具,提高效率。比如,通过脚本自动运行一些基础测试,这样就能节省大量时间,让测试人员有更多精力去关注细节问题。
最后,建议建立一个测试清单,把每个渠道的关键测试点列出来,每次发布新版本时,按照清单逐一测试,避免遗漏重要环节。
总之,多渠道发布虽然复杂,但只要做好差异化测试,就能有效保障产品质量,提升用户体验。不需要太专业的知识,只要用心、有条理地测试,就能轻松应对各种挑战。